China for a Global SHIFT NI 项目-银行与金融项目经理(Beijing)
2009-11-10 12:44:57

Mission of the Initiative:

WWF China has developed a major work program with the Chinese financial sector. This work is being delivered via one of WWFs initiatives, China for a Global Shift Initiative (China SHIFT), which is one of 14 global priority programs within the WWF network. China SHIFT is working with individual institutions, regulators and across the finance sector as a whole to promote more responsible lending and investment practices.

This work forms one of the four key programs of the China SHIFT program and is of strategic importance to both the WWF China office and wider WWF network. The post will suit a senior and experienced individual who is used to operating at the highest levels with FIs and regulators with strong environment and sustainability focus. The Program Manager will be supported in this program by a small team of Beijing based staff, as well as WWF network specialists.
